Can Vaseline with Urea Cream Get Rid of Stretch Marks?

Vaseline plus urea cream will not get rid of stretch marks. Vaseline is a mineral oil derived from petroleum. Because petroleum jelly does not dissolve in water, and the ductility is relatively poor compared to other oils, can lock the water, play the role of moisturizing, widely used in all kinds of skin medication and skin care products. Urea cream is mainly composed of urea, which also contains some petroleum jelly and other ingredients, the main role is also moisturizing. Stretch marks are the result of the increased abdominal circumference of pregnancy causing the skin to pull more than the skin can withstand, resulting in the breakage of elastic fibers and collagen fibers. Vaseline plus urea cream does not have any effect on the elastin fibers and collagen fibers, and therefore does not have the effect of getting rid of stretch marks. In fact, there are very few medical treatments that can effectively remove stretch marks, and they are not effective. If the scar is stabilized, treatments such as fractional laser and Thermage can be taken to improve the scar in the mature stage.
